I guess this would have been a fun watch if I was in my tender years. It's cute though. There's some pacing issues along the way, and some elements in it can feel a bit generic and uninteresting. I enjoyed the characterization given to our protagonist, but it feels that everything that we need to know about her is told way to quickly. Wish that Colorido's follow up to 'Penguin Highway' had been more visually striking. I can at least get it since Hiroyasu Ishida wasn't set as director for this one. It still manages to look comfy for most of the time. But really there isn'tthat much remarkable on this one.
